Who We Are
The RISE Group is an employee-owned, professional engineering firm that provides a complete range of consulting, design, and energy services to customers throughout the United States and internationally. Our multi-disciplined engineering and technical staff specialize in failure analysis, engineering design, process optimization, and condition assessment. RISE Group Inc.'s 13 open roles are across all levels, and about 8% are remote or hybrid. The most active teams are business operations, account management, and sales. RISE Group Inc. operates across energy services and skilled trades, with roles spanning field installation, project coordination, supply chain, and technical sales. The company employs between 501 and 1,000 people and hires across both hands-on trades positions and corporate functions. Most RISE Group Inc. roles are based in Cranston, with some in Worcester and Braintree.
